National final season has come to an end and we now have the chosen ones who will move on to compete at Eurovision. However, many of the other entries that didn’t make it will remain on our playlists for some time. To celebrate these acts, it’s time for our countdown of Team Wiwi’s Top 50 national final songs of Eurovision 2025.

The team here at wiwibloggs have voted for our favourite songs that competed in the national finals for Eurovision 2025 but were not selected for Basel. Over 140 of this year’s songs received points from our jurors. Now, we’re ready to share which of them made it into our Top 50. We’ll reveal ten tracks each day until we reach the winner.

Note this is not an objective list, but is determined by the personal votes of a panel of wiwibloggers. We encourage you to share your own personal favourites in the comments.

Our top national final songs of Eurovision 2025 ranking is determined by independent votes from a panel of wiwibloggers. They are: Lucy, Ruxandra, Pablo, Lukas, Mario, Calvin, Tom, Cinan, Renske, Antranig, Jordi, Ron, Scarlett, and Jonathan.
